Here is a barn find most Ford enthusiasts can only dream about. We just rescued this 1959 ford galaxy 500 Skyliner retractable hardtop from a barn last weekend, where it has been in storage for the last 30 years. The first few photos in the listing show the car just after it was pulled from the barn and loaded on the flatbed. We took it back to the shop, pressure washed off the worst of the dirt, and put 4 good tires on it and gave it a good look over. It has a V8 motor with a standard floor shift transmission, although the car was originally an automatic. It was driven into the barn back in the 80s, but the motor is frozen now, you might be able to free it up with a bit of work, but we haven,t had the time to try. The engine is all there except for the air cleaner. The glass is all good except for the passenger window which is cracked. The car is remarkably solid for its age. I pulled up the carpets where I could and only found one small hole which is shown in the pictures. The seats are in amazingly good shape, they cleaned right up, and look almost as good as new. The inner door panels are with the car and are also in very good shape. Sorry, I forgot pictures of them. We hooked up booster cables to the car and played with the roof controls, and managed to get the trunk lid up enough to take some pictures inside it. The trunk floor appears very solid as well. We weren,t able to get the top to work properly, although all the solenoids and screw jacks seemed to be working. Not surprising considering the amount of time its been in storage. On to the body. There is damage on the drivers side door and quarter panel, but it is repairable. Both quarter panels appear to have been replaced at one time, we figured during the 70s judging from the bronze welding technique which was used. The car comes with a re-chromed rear bumper as well. Overall it is an excellent starting project for a restoration, or get it running and drive it as a "survivor". Fully restored Skyliners are fetching big money today.
